Hearing Weird Appears
When unusual sounds like touching and also knocking on your machine, this indicates sediment buildup. It belongs to sedimentary rocks, which are hard and make a great deal of noise when banging against metal. If left neglected, these pieces can create splits on the steel, creating leaks.
You can still conserve your water heating system by draining it and also cleansing it. Simply be cautious since dealing with this is harmful, whether it is a gas or electric unit.
Producing Insufficient Hot Water
If there is inadequate warm water for you and your household, yet you haven't transformed your consumption habits, then that's the sign that your water heater is failing. Typically, expanding family members and an additional shower room suggest that you need to scale approximately a bigger device to meet your demands.
When everything is the exact same, yet your water heater all of a sudden does not meet your hot water needs, take into consideration a specialist assessment because your maker is not performing to requirement.
Experiencing Fluctuations in Temperature Level
Your water heater has a thermostat, as well as the water produced ought to remain around that same temperature level you establish for the system. Nonetheless, if your water becomes as well cool or as well hot suddenly, it could indicate that your water heater thermostat is no more doing its task. Initially, test points out by using a marker and also tape. Examine to see later on if the marking steps on its own. If it does, it suggests your heating unit is unstable.
Seeing Leakages and also Puddles
Check to screws, pipes, as well as ports when you see a water leakage. You might simply need to tighten a few of them. Nevertheless, if you see pools collected at the end of the home heating device, you have to call for an immediate assessment since it reveals you have actually obtained an energetic leakage that could be a concern with your container itself or the pipelines.

Aging Beyond Requirement Life Expectancy
If your hot water heater is greater than 10 years old, you have to consider replacing it. That's the all-natural life expectancy of this device! With proper maintenance, you can expand it for a couple of more years. In contrast, without a routine tune-up, the lifespan can be shorter. WHAT CAUSES A WATER HEATER TO BREAK?
Whether gas or electric, water heaters typically last 10-13 years – if you pay attention to them. Sometimes, a water heater will start leaking near the supply lines, and if you don't correct the leak, it could not only damage your surrounding floor and drywall but also lead to corrosion and failure. Other common causes of water heater failure are internal rust, sediment buildup and high water pressure. Improper sizing can also cause your water heater to burst unexpectedly, leaving you with a huge, expensive mess.
